What is the Apache Server Backdoor?

An Apache server backdoor is a vulnerability that cybercriminals can use to gain unauthorized access to your server. It allows them to bypass authentication and gain full access to your server’s file system, as well as any data that’s stored on it.

The backdoor is typically placed on a server through malicious code injected into a server’s codebase. Once it’s installed, it can be used to steal sensitive data, upload malware, and even take over your entire server.

How Does the Apache Server Backdoor Work?

The Apache server backdoor works by exploiting a vulnerability in the Apache software. It typically involves injecting malicious code into the server’s codebase, which gives the attacker a foothold into the system.

Once the backdoor is installed, it can be used to execute arbitrary code, upload and download files, and even create new user accounts with administrative privileges. This gives the attacker complete control over your server and all the data stored on it.

What are the Signs of an Apache Server Backdoor?

The signs of an Apache server backdoor can be difficult to detect, but there are some things to look out for. Some of the signs include:

  • Unusual log entries in your server’s logs
  • Files that have been modified or deleted without explanation
  • New user accounts or groups that you don’t remember creating
  • Odd network traffic patterns that can’t be accounted for
  • Unexpected system behavior, such as slow performance or crashes

How Can You Protect Your Server from the Apache Server Backdoor?

There are several steps you can take to protect your server from the Apache server backdoor.

  • Keep your server software up to date
  • Use strong passwords and two-factor authentication
  • Monitor your server logs regularly for unusual activity
  • Use firewalls and other security measures to block malicious traffic
  • Regularly scan your server for vulnerabilities and malware
  • Restrict access to sensitive data and files
